### Changelog: Proctorline queue defaults

Heads up for the sync — we changed the defaults on the Proctorline exam-proctoring queue. Sessions were piling up during morning exam windows because the dequeue batch size was tiny and the idle timeout was way too generous. Batching is bigger now, stale sessions get reaped faster, and reviewers see less lag. Here are the updated queue configuration values.

service settings:
PRAIX_LOG_LEVEL=error
PRAIX_METRICS_HOST=metrics.praix.qorvelcorp.corp
PRAIX_POOL_SIZE=16

## Pop-Up Office — Tarnfield Expo Hall

Facilities desk: during the Brindle Trade Fair we run a pop-up office in Unit 14 of the Tarnfield Expo Hall, open daily 08:00–19:00. Staff the desk in pairs and log all equipment loans in the ledger. The unit shares a loading corridor with two other exhibitors, so keep the shutter down when unattended. Venue security patrols hourly but does not hold our keys. The rear service door is our only out-of-hours entry and takes the code below.

door code, yagap-bahof: bdg-O-05

## Onboarding: Farebranch Rules Engine

Plugin authors integrate with Farebranch by registering fee rules against the evaluation API. Rules are sandboxed; they cannot perform network calls directly. All rate-table lookups go through the host, which validates your plugin manifest at load time. Your local env file must include the signing credential the host uses to verify manifests, set on the next line.

secret setting of bajef-fajof: COURIER_KEY3=76c

Off-site Run Checklist — Sample Shipment to Corvane Labs

[ ] Samples boxed, cold packs checked, seals numbered.
[ ] Manifest printed in duplicate; one copy inside the box.
[ ] Courier: Redfern Express, morning slot only.
[ ] Log departure time at the desk.
[ ] No hand-over without the manifest countersigned. Confidential hand-over instruction for the driver:

courier memo of fajeg-yahif: the ulaael belath courier leaves the zoriel novwyn pelys ledger at gate 1311 under passcode 386270